IMPROVE YOUR ENGLISH
English for speakers of other languages ESOL
WMC offers FREE English courses for people whose first language is not English, but who have now made London their home (e.g. refugees, asylum seekers and permanent residents. The department run classes at different levels and both in the day and evening.
ESOL COURSES
| Beginners | E1a | Entry 1 |
| Elementary | E1b | Entry 1 |
| Pre-Intermediate | E2 | Entry 2 |
| Intermediate | E3 | Entry 3 |
| Higher Intermediate | L1 | Level 1 |
| Advanced | L2 | Level 1 |
The courses develop four language skills in English : listening, speaking, reading and writing. You will work towards nationally recognised qualifications. You can learn how to use computers to support your language learning.

LITERACY AND NUMERACY
WMC offers FREE classes from Beginners right up to Pre-GCSE level. You will work towards nationally recognised qualifications. WMC runs these classes at different levels in the day or in the evening. You can improve your reading or writing with Literacy classes. You can improve your number skills and maths with Numeracy classes.
